Ford


Price: $53,645
Mileage: 15 City / 23 Hwy

Really, the ordinary Mustang GT, with its 412-horsepower 5.0-liter V8, should be plenty of car for just about anyone. But there are always those who want more... and more.

So Ford offers the 550-horsepower Shelby GT500 for those folks. This car makes smoking the back tires easier than sparking up an electric grill. A process of continuous improvement over the last several years has turned the GT500 into a car that's good for more than just straight-line take-offs, too. This is a Shelby that's prepared for the curves as well...
